Is Your Water Pressure Up To Par?

Are you dealing with low water pressure in your home? It can be a significant inconvenience, impacting everything from showering to cleaning. Before calling a plumber, consider performing a static water system test. This simple method can help you pinpoint the source of your low pressure issue and minimize potential costs on repairs.

A static flow test involves gauging the water pressure in your plumbing system when no water is being used. This provides a baseline reading that can be contrasted to industry standards.

  • To conduct a static test, you'll require a pressure gauge and a few supplies.
  • Attach the gauge to your water main pipe.
  • Turn off all faucets and appliances in your house.
  • Allow the pressure to stabilize for a few minutes.
  • Note the pressure reading on your gauge.
